The education loans covers:

  • Tuition and Education Fees.
  • Fees for the library, laboratory, and hostel.
  • Purchase of books, equipment, instruments, and uniform.
  • Travel expenses.
  • Caution money, refundable expenses, and so on.

The eligibility check for a study loan to abroad require:

  • The applicant must be of Indian origin.
  • Students between the ages of 18 – 35 can apply for an education loan.
  • The applicant must have a confirmed admission to a foreign institution.
  • The applicant must have an excellent academic record.
  • The applicant must have a co-borrower, such as parents or guardians, who will act as a guarantor for the loan.
  • A collateral deposit may be required to secure an education loan.
  • The applicant must be accompanied by a co-borrower, such as parents or guardians.

  • Mark sheet for the most recent qualifying examination.
  • Proof of Admission.
  • Expense schedule for the course.
  • a copy of the letter confirming the scholarship. (if any)
  • Two passport-sized photos.
  • Statement of the borrower’s bank account for the previous six months.
  • Income tax assessment order that is no more than two years old.
  • A summary of the borrower’s assets and liabilities.
